High quality and delivers excellent shaves
Update Nov 12, 2020:The razor suddenly stopped working about five weeks ago. When I plugged it in to charge a flashing small red battery symbol appeared on the handle. I sent a service request to Braun on their website along with a copy of the Amazon invoice. Braun quickly sent shipping instructions along with a prepaid UPS shipping label. A new replacement razor arrived from Braun about two weeks later. This replacement razor is more powerful and runs faster like my original 7 year old razor (which still runs great). The replacement also runs much longer on a charge. Obviously the first razor that failed was defective from the start and I am very pleased with the performance of its replacement. Braun service was easy to use and I am still a fan of Braun products and I highly recommend this razor.I purchased this razor to replace my 7 year old model 7. I like this series of Braun razors because they have an electronic motor instead of the old brush motors still used by other brands. I use foam shaving cream and water with these razors for a superior shave.I had used Panasonic razors prior to my first Braun but they had to be replaced every year or two when water got in the case. I replaced my 7 year old Braun because it didnt seem to give a close shave and even new replacement heads did not improve the shave.This new Braun series is quiet and it seems to run a little slower than the older model. I have found it best to move the shaver a little slower and it cuts close with fewer passes.I it says three weeks of battery life but I think that would be true if you just have peach fuzz. I would guess a weeks worth on one charge is about right bit I charge about every three days since I probably run ten minutes per shave.It will give a very close shave and it is totally waterproof so shave in the shower if you like. Excellent quality and worth every penny that it costs. Recommend any brand of shaving cream for a really fine shace.

Not quite as good as Panasonic 5 blade razors
I use this as both a face and head shaver, so keep that in mind. I use Cremo shave cream with any shaver I use. Also, I've used quite a few models of shavers, and IMO Panasonic 5 blade units are a good metric to compare to.Likes: The head the pretty compact, which is good for both face and head shaving. For head shaving, compact heads are great for working near your ears and on the back of your neck. For face shaving, your nose. Battery life is as good as all of the Panasonic units I've used (3,4 and 5 blade models) and charging time is fast. Its pretty easy to clean. The blades, when new, are great for face shaving, IMO better than the Panasonic. When new.Also, I've found that with my Panasonic, I can occasionally get an ingrown hair or two on my cheeks, that never happened with the Braun. Also, the shaver can survive a drop, it accidentally fallen off my shower shelf twice and survived both drops.Dislikes: The blades aren't quite as good as Panasonics blades for head shaving. They wear out extremely fast. Panasonic blades can last almost a year, and that's with both face and head shaving. The foil on the first set of Braun blades wore out in 4 months. The foil on the second set wore out in 3, then I bought another Panasonic shaver. The compact head does mean that the blades have to do more work, so the shaver can bog down at times, where the Panasonic would power through.If you're *only* using it for face shaving, I'd recommend it. However, if there isnt a great price difference between it and a Panasonic 5 blade model, or if you also need it for a head shaver, I'd go for the Panasonic.
